> --- linux-next-20200717.orig/fs/reiserfs/reiserfs.h
> +++ linux-next-20200717/fs/reiserfs/reiserfs.h
> @@ -1109,7 +1109,7 @@ int is_reiserfs_jr(struct reiserfs_super
> * ReiserFS leaves the first 64k unused, so that partition labels have
> * enough space. If someone wants to write a fancy bootloader that
> * needs more than 64k, let us know, and this will be increased in size.
> - * This number must be larger than than the largest block size on any
> + * This number must be larger than the largest block size on any
> * platform, or code will break. -Hans
> */
> #define REISERFS_DISK_OFFSET_IN_BYTES (64 * 1024)
